One of the most strong elements of gambling is its psychological result. Successful triggers the brain’s reward procedure, releasing dopamine and making a experience of excitement. This rush can speedily become addictive, creating gamers chase that feeling continuously. The "in the vicinity of-pass up" outcome—every time a participant will come near profitable—results in the illusion that victory is just one far more wager absent, encouraging even further Engage in. Many gamblers also engage in "chasing losses," believing they will Recuperate shed funds with the next wager. This cycle can cause economic spoil, strained relationships, and severe mental health problems for example nervousness and despair.
